Hey all — quick note before the sync. We traced the rounding drift in Centavo's FX conversions to stale rates cached under the old credential, so we rotated it as part of the fix. Half-cent errors should stop accumulating now. Please update your local configs before Thursday's deploy. The new key for the internal rates service is below.

API key for tagug-tajef: vxb4-R1fo

Alert: nightly-backfill-stalled

Heads up — the Crambake scheduler hasn't kicked off the nightly backfill run within its usual window. Usually this just means a stuck lock from the previous run, and a quick requeue sorts it out. If customers mention stale dashboards, that's why. Triage steps, requeue instructions, and who to ping after hours are all on the internal page.

wiki page, tahaf-tajog: https://jira.ordindyn.corp/pipeline

## Limits & Quotas: Cron → Driftline Workflows

All nightly cron jobs in Marrowtide move to Driftline. Reviewers: check that no task exceeds the per-tenant run quota, retries are bounded, and fan-out stays under the shard cap. Anything over quota must be split or scheduled off-peak. The enforced tuning constants for this migration are as follows.

constants for tageg-kagag:
QUOTAS = {
    "kelax": 495,
    "istath": 366,
    "tammir": 108,
    "novdor": 730,
    "casax": 816,
    "quenael": 874,
    "pelius": 403,
}

## Releases

Version 5.3 of Thumbline ships the fix for the image-cache memory leak: decoded frames are now released on eviction instead of lingering until process exit. Release managers must tag the build, run the soak test on the Orvis bench for two hours, and sign the artifact before publication. Signing is mandatory; unsigned builds are rejected. Sign using the key below:

release key, fahaf-bajof: bky3_Xam

Minutes — Management Meeting, Branch Managers Circulation

Attendees reviewed the warranty-cost overrun on the Ferrowin pump range, now 34% above forecast. Root cause traced to a seal batch from the Claversham plant. Remediation: revised inspection protocol effective immediately; reserve adjustment approved. Branch managers should log all related claims under the new code. The broader commercial context is noted below.

board note of yadup-fajef: Druiusox Holdings is in early talks to buy Norwynek Systems for about $186.0 million. The Kaseth launch date is June 24, and nothing goes to the press before then. Legal wants the Quenethek Group term sheet withdrawn before November 27.